"Pycnanthemum muticum, Clustered Mountain Mint, is a clump forming, aromatic perennial that naturally occurs in most of the Eastern half of the United States. Given the right conditions, this plant will spread by rhizomes; if spreading is not desired you can prune the roots in the spring.

 

"This Mountain Mint sports leaves that are more ovate than others of the Pycnanthemum genus, but they possess the same minty aroma. From mid to late summer the foliage is adorned by clusters of small pinkish white flowers that will attract a multitude of pollinators! Despite the name, Clustered Mountain Mint and similar species in the genus do not grow in the mountains. Also called Blunt Mountain Mint or Short Toothed Mountain Mint." (Description via PrairieMoon.com, our seed source.) Grows to 3 feet high, and blooms in July/August/September.
